Overview

SN74V293-7PZA from Texas Instruments is a 65536 × 18 / 131072 × 9, 3.3-V CMOS first-in, first-out (FIFO) memory with independent read/write clocks, user-selectable ×9/×18 bus sizing, and FWFT/standard timing modes. It delivers 166-MHz operation, 6-ns read/write cycle time, and zero-latency retransmit for high-throughput data buffering in telecom and video systems.

For engineers reviewing the SN74V293-7PZA datasheet, SN74V293-7PZA pinout, SN74V293-7PZA application, or SN74V293-7PZA equivalent, key selection considerations include its 80-pin TQFP package, 5-V-tolerant inputs, programmable almost-empty/almost-full flags with eight default offsets, big/little-endian byte formatting, and dual-mode retransmit latency control via RM pin.

Technical Context

This FIFO implements asynchronous dual-clock architecture with fully independent RCLK and WCLK domains-each operable from 0 to 166 MHz-with no frequency ratio constraints. Its RAM array is sized at 65536 × 18 (or 131072 × 9), supporting flexible bus-matching via IW/OW pins during master reset.

It integrates configurable flag logic including EF/OR, FF/IR, HF, PAE, and PAF; all programmable via serial (SEN/FWFT/SI) or parallel (WEN/LD/Dn) methods. Retransmit is initiated by RT on RCLK edge, with zero-latency mode selectable via RM pin during MRS, and timing mode (FWFT vs. standard) set by FWFT/SI state at reset.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Memory Depth × Width65536 × 18 or 131072 × 9 - enables large-burst buffering with scalable data path matching
Max Clock Frequency166 MHz - supports high-speed DSP and network interface timing budgets
Read/Write Cycle Time6 ns - guarantees sub-10 ns latency for real-time streaming applications
Bus Configuration×9/×18 input and output ports - configurable via IW/OW pins without external logic
Retransmit LatencyZero-latency or normal mode - selected by RM pin at master reset for deterministic replay
Flag ProgrammabilityPAE/PAF with 8 default offsets - loaded serially or in parallel, supporting adaptive flow control
Input Voltage Tolerance5-V-tolerant inputs - simplifies interfacing with mixed-voltage legacy controllers

Pinout & Package

SN74V293-7PZA is housed in an 80-pin Thin Quad Flat Pack (TQFP) package (PZA), RoHS-compliant, with 0.5-mm pitch and exposed thermal pad. Pin functions are validated per TI SCAS669D datasheet Figure 1 and Table 1.

Pin/TerminalCircuit RoleDesign Meaning
MRSMaster Reset InputAsynchronous initialization of pointers, flags, and configuration registers; required after power-up
WCLK / RCLKIndependent Clock InputsEnable concurrent write/read operations; each supports 0–166 MHz with no inter-clock dependency
WEN / RENWrite/Read Enable ControlsGate data transfer on respective clock edges; ignored when FIFO is full/empty
OEOutput EnablePlaces Q0–Q17 outputs in high-impedance state for bus sharing or power savings
RTRetransmit TriggerOn rising RCLK edge, resets read pointer to start address-zero-latency if RM = low at MRS
IW / OWInput/Output Width SelectSet ×9 or ×18 port sizing during MRS; determines D0–D17/Q0–Q17 usage and bus alignment
BEBig/Little-Endian ControlSelects MSB-first or LSB-first word ordering during ×18→×9 conversion
FWFT/SIMode Select / Serial InputHigh at MRS enables first-word fall-through; post-reset serves as serial load pin for offset registers

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Flexible Bus Matching×9/×18 input and output ports independently configurable via IW/OW pins-eliminates glue logic for heterogeneous bus interfaces
Zero-Latency RetransmitRT-triggered re-read starts outputting first word on same RCLK edge-critical for deterministic replay in packet processing
Programmable Flag OffsetsPAE/PAF thresholds set via 8 factory defaults or custom values-enables adaptive buffer watermarking without firmware overhead
Dual Timing ModesFWFT mode delivers first word after 3 RCLK edges without REN; standard mode requires explicit REN-supports both burst and demand-driven access
5-V-Tolerant InputsAll control and data inputs accept 5-V signals at 3.3-V VCC-enables direct connection to legacy 5-V microcontrollers or FPGAs

FAQ

What is the maximum operating frequency of the SN74V293-7PZA?

The SN74V293-7PZA supports up to 166 MHz on both read and write clocks, with no requirement for clock synchronization or frequency ratio constraints. This allows full utilization of its 6-ns read/write cycle time in high-bandwidth applications such as telecom line cards and video frame buffers. The SN74V293-7PZA achieves this performance using TI's high-speed submicron CMOS process.

Does the SN74V293-7PZA support 5-V logic inputs?

Yes, the SN74V293-7PZA features 5-V-tolerant inputs across all control and data pins (D0–D17, WEN, REN, MRS, etc.), enabling direct interface with legacy 5-V microcontrollers, FPGAs, or level-shifting-free connections to mixed-voltage systems. This capability is explicitly confirmed in the SCAS669D datasheet and applies to the SN74V293-7PZA regardless of VCC = 3.3 V operation.

How does the first-word fall-through (FWFT) mode work on the SN74V293-7PZA?

In FWFT mode-enabled by asserting FWFT/SI high during master reset-the first word written to an empty SN74V293-7PZA appears on Q0–Q17 after exactly three RCLK rising edges, without requiring REN assertion. Subsequent words still require REN. This reduces initial latency for burst-start applications like packet forwarding or video frame capture, and is distinct from standard mode where every read, including the first, needs REN.

Can the SN74V293-7PZA be used to expand memory depth beyond 65536 words?

Yes, the SN74V293-7PZA supports depth expansion via FWFT-mode chaining: the Q outputs of one device connect directly to the D inputs of the next, with shared RCLK/WCLK and synchronized flag logic. No external glue logic is needed because FWFT ensures seamless handoff of the first word from upstream to downstream FIFO. This capability is documented in the SCAS669D application notes for TI DSP interfacing.

What is the function of the RM pin on the SN74V293-7PZA?

The RM (Retransmit Latency Mode) pin selects zero-latency or normal-latency retransmit behavior during master reset: RM = low enables zero-latency mode, where the first retransmitted word appears on Q outputs on the same RCLK edge that samples RT low. RM = high selects normal latency, requiring one additional RCLK cycle. This setting persists until next MRS and directly affects deterministic replay timing in protocols like SRTP or video ARQ.
